What’s Official? Here’s the ice cream scoop:
• Album name: The Life of a Showgirl. Confirmed on the New Heights podcast with Travis and Jason Kelce.
• Release date: October 3, 2025
• 12 tracks. Taylor made it clear: “This is 12.. no bonuses, no deluxe additions.”
• Titles include The Fate of Ophelia, Opalite, Elizabeth Taylor, Father Figure, Actually Romantic, CANCELLED!, Honey, and the title track.. the last one.. featuring Sabrina Carpenter!! ~Screaming, Crying, Throwing up.~
• Produced exclusively by Max Martin and Shellback, with Taylor as co-producer.
• Conceived and recorded during the European leg of Eras, with Taylor literally flying to Sweden between shows to write and record.
• It’s a dive “behind the curtain” she wrote while running a literal showgirl marathon.
• The cover: Taylor submerged in mint-green water, wearing a rhinestone chain dress. Shot by Mert Alas & Marcus Piggott. It channels cabaret-era glam, a (much ANTICIPATED) glitter gel pen font, and shattered collage textures. These are the same photographers from our beloved Reputation Era!
